A new article from an Australia news site is reporting: ‘Woomera Range Complex: United States testing new Hypersonic Attack Cruise Missile on Australian soil - Secretive testing of an advanced hypersonic weapon capable of travelling at five times the speed of sound is believed to be underway in remote South Australia.’ According to the article,: “Initially the missile is fired by a rocket booster where it accelerates to hypersonic speeds, and then an ‘air-breathing’ scramjet ‘cruiser’ engine takes over for the cruise and terminal stages, before the weapon then reaches its target. Analysts say the high-speed, highly maneuverable air-breathing weapons can achieve longer ranges compared to traditional rocket-based systems, which carry both fuel and oxidizer, and warn China and Russia are already well ahead on the scramjet technology.” https://thenightly.com.au/politics/woomera-range-complex-united-states-tipped-to-soon-test-new-hypersonic-attack-cruise-missile-in-australia-c-22002970 It would seem totally logical to me that if the U.S. already had Lockheed Martin manufactured ’Tic Tacs’, or ‘Alien Reproduction Vehicles’, then such technology would be totally redundant and unnecessary. Why would any ot the world's warring countries continue developing scramjet technology if they already possess antigravity vehicles capable of performance that allegedly defies known physics?
